Nettet1. des. 2024 · As part of Elevated Chicago's Steering Committee, Lesle' has infused her poetry, art, expertise in youth engagement and … NettetThe first block is a 'start' block. The second block is a 'move steering' block with mode set to 'rotations'.The steering value is set to zero, so the robot will move in a straight line, the power is set to +50 so the robot will move forward at 50% power, the number of rotations is set to two and the option to apply the brake after the motion is 'on'.

http://www.legoengineering.com/why-doesnt-my-robot-drive-straight/ NettetThe Move Steering block makes your robot turn by running the two motors at different speeds. For very tight turns, one of the motors will be reversed. Note that the Degrees and Rotation inputs measure the amount of motor rotation of the faster motor, not the change in the robot’s direction when turning.

The second option in the Move Steering block regulates the power of the motor. It is measured in percent and could be from -100% to +100%. A hundred percent means to use the maximum power that the motor is able to provide. Zero power means that the motor does not move at all.
